The management structure of Delhaize Group is organized around:
- The Board of Directors, which approves the strategy of Delhaize Group as well as the budget and investments, supervises the company, appoints the Chief Executive Officer and the members of the Executive Committee and determines their compensation
- The Executive Committee, which prepares the strategy proposals for the Board of Directors, oversees the operational activities and analyzes the business performance of Delhaize Group

Executive Committee
The Executive Committee of Delhaize Group prepares the strategy proposals for the Board of Directors, oversees the operational activities and analyzes the business performance of Delhaize Group. The Executive Committee is composed of the following persons:
| Name |
Position |
Member Since |
| Pierre-Olivier Beckers |
President and Chief Executive Officer |
1990
|
| Rick A. Anicetti |
Executive Vice President |
2002
|
| Stéfan Descheemaeker |
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er |
2009
|
| Michel Eeckhout |
Executive Vice President |
2005
|
| Ronald C. Hodge |
Executive Vice President |
2002
|
| Nicolas Hollanders |
Executive Vice President |
2007
|
| Michael Waller |
Executive Vice President and General Counsel |
2001
|

Group Support Functions
- Finance department and Risk Management: Stéfan Descheemaeker is Delhaize Group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er.
- Legal affairs and Human Resources department: Michael Waller is Delhaize Group Senior Vice President and General Counsel.
- IT department: Terry Morgan is Delhaize Group Vice President and Chief Information Officer.
